So where is the balance that keeps the game fun for civilians so they don't get constantly robbed by 4 deep cars?

Unrealistic portrayal of robberies and characters which exist only to conduct robberies is bannable, for example:

  • driving into the county as a gang member in South Central to conduct a robbery in Paleto Bay for no sensible IC reason (e.g. your path has not realistically led you to Paleto Bay for any discernable reason, this would be a significant drive on an IC basis);
  • driving on a dirt bike with masks, not communicating, but pulling up to any pedestrian to conduct a gun-point robbery at drive-by;
  • chaining robberies unrealistically, or unrealistic portrayal of a crime spree;
  • moving from robbery to robbery and demanding victims move as quickly as possible, or clearly conducting robberies simply to gain OOC assets rather than for roleplay;
  • conducting robberies with overuse of force (such as 4 assault rifles) or for the purpose of provoking conflict (seeking to rob people in a gang neighborhood for an excuse to shoot them);
  • attempting to kidnap someone for the sole purpose of mugging them.

You can find more under Rule 10)

also including special feature

 

It is forbidden to mug anyone when:

  • you're using a vehicle in an unplanned petty mugging for quick cash, unless admin approved;
  • you've travelled miles away from your characters' residential anchor to mug someone;
